    I'm getting the following error in AE when trying to import an R3D file:
    'After Effects: AEGP Plugin AAF error occurred while creating project:
    (5027 :: 12)'

    I'm using the latest version of AE CS4 with the update 9.0.1.51 with the Red CS4 Plugin.

    Is anybody else getting the same issue?
